anger a strong feeling caused when someone or something has done something wrong to you or when you think that something is bad or not fair.
apartment one or more rooms that people live in and that are part of a building.
boil1 the state of a liquid when it reaches a certain temperature and starts to turn into a gas.
born a past participle of bear1.
both one and the other of two things or people.
bottom the lowest or deepest part of something.
flute an instrument for playing music. It is a long tube made of metal or wood that you play by blowing into a hole at one end.
fog a thick cloud that is near to the ground.
mix to put different things together so that the parts become one.
powerful having great physical strength.
quietly with little or no sound.
slime a slippery liquid, such as thin mud or the slippery substance on fish.
smart intelligent; knowing a lot.
staff a pole or rod often used as an aid in walking or hiking; walking stick.
swallow to cause food to go from the mouth to the stomach.
